Can you comment on what maintenance, if any, has been done already? Brake pads or rotors replaced? Tires? Just curious to know what to expect.

Since the mileage is mostly highway, I am still using the original tires, brakes, etc. I have only had scheduled maintenance and a couple of warranty items.

The warranty items were the center display, an antenna splitter, and an air conditioner filter.

Every service has been terrific. The car was finished on time, cleaned and I was always given a Mercedes as a loner.
